Различные вопросы по PHP и MySQL

253K
.
(\/)____o_O____(\/)

Udesign, select sum(`field`) from `table`

.
# Koenig (01.04.2017 / 13:45)
Udesign, select sum(`field`) from `table`
select sum(`столбец`) from `таблица` так
.

Koenig, Спасибо все работает как надо

.
Udesign

а как можно сделать так 1 234 567,13 а не так 1234567,1234567

.
# Udesign (01.04.2017 / 14:44)
а как можно сделать так 1 234 567,13 а не так 1234567,1234567
echo round(1234567.1234567, 2); // 1234567.12
.

Udesign, Если с округлением в большую сторону, тогда так

$int = 1234567.1254567;

echo round($int, 2, PHP_ROUND_HALF_UP); // 1234567.13
.

ДоХтор, Спасибо все как надо работает

.

А можно сделать так 1 234 567,00 рублей а не так 1234567,00 р

.
# Udesign (01.04.2017 / 16:45)
А можно сделать так 1 234 567,00 рублей а не так 1234567,00 р
$int = 1234567.1254567;

echo number_format($int, 2, ',', ' ');
.
# ДоХтор (01.04.2017 / 16:56)
$int = 1234567.1254567;

echo number_format($int, 2, ',', ' ');
Так правильно будет?

$int = 1234567.1254567;

echo number_format( round($int, 2, PHP_ROUND_HALF_UP), 2, ',', ' ');
или проста echo number_format($int, 2, ',', ' ');
и будет выводит 1 234 567,12 так
Всего: 7969